Neuronal innervation of breast cancer promotes metastatic dissemination

2025-11-29

Abstract excerpt

Metastasis is a leading cause of mortality in breast cancer patients, yet the signaling promoting metastatic dissemination is not completely understood. Prior literature implicates neuronal innervation in tumor progression, including recent studies in breast cancer progression with the 4T1 and PyMT cell line orthotopic injection models.
